Address 111.4946228 DCR

DsTVXKx6n7PusV3nJYQPEQ6aEPntefoZPB8

Confirmed

Total Received111.4946228 DCR
Total Sent0 DCR
Final Balance111.4946228 DCR
No. Transactions1

Transactions

DsTVXKx6n7PusV3nJYQPEQ6aEPntefoZPB8111.4946228 DCR ×
DsmVENzSmbR4gpDKbocXPzSBAvKJRzpNsuc21.89179001 DCR
Fee: 0.000419 DCR
575988 Confirmations133.38641281 DCR